Common Foundation Pouring Jobs
Foundation Pouring - Essential for creating a stable base for residential and commercial structures.
Basement Foundations - Provides a strong foundation for homes with basements or underground spaces.
Slab Foundations - Commonly used for single-story buildings and ground-level structures.
Pier and Beam Foundations - Suitable for uneven terrain, elevating the structure above the ground.
Retrofitting Foundations - Reinforces existing foundations to improve stability and prevent settling.
Foundation Repair - Addresses cracks, shifts, or other issues to maintain structural integrity.
Foundation Pouring Questions
What types of projects require foundation pouring? Foundation pouring is commonly needed for new construction, additions, or repair of existing foundations in residential or commercial properties.
How is the foundation poured? The process involves excavating the site, setting forms, placing reinforcement, and then pouring concrete to create a stable base.
What should property owners know about foundation preparation? Proper site preparation, including soil assessment and form setup, is essential for a durable and level foundation.
Are there different types of foundation pours? Yes, common types include slab-on-grade, basement, and crawl space foundations, each suited to different building needs.
